16) Lays between 5-8 eggs per breeding season
The Azure-winged magpie typically lays between 5-8 eggs per breeding season. This clutch size is common among many bird species, allowing a higher probability of at least some chicks surviving to adulthood.
Egg-laying usually occurs during the springtime, matching with the period when food resources are abundant. This timing ensures that the chicks have a good chance of being fed adequately.
Both parents participate in the incubation and the feeding of the chicks. The cooperation between the pair increases the survival rate of the offspring, making sure they receive enough warmth and nutrition.
The eggs are incubated for about 15-16 days before hatching. Once the chicks emerge, they are helpless and require constant care and feeding for several weeks. By the time they fledge, they are better equipped to survive independently.

18) Engage in cooperative breeding, where other group members help raise young.
Azure-winged magpies participate in cooperative breeding, a social system where non-breeding individuals assist in raising the young. These helpers contribute to tasks such as feeding the chicks and defending the nest from predators.
Cooperative breeding increases the survival rate of the young and reduces the pressure on the parent birds. By sharing responsibilities, parent birds can ensure that their offspring receive consistent care and protection.
Non-breeding helpers gain experience in caretaking and receive protection from the group. This experience improves their own breeding success when they eventually have their own offspring. This communal effort exemplifies the social nature of Azure-winged magpies.

Geographic Range
The geographic range of the azure-winged magpie extends across parts of East Asia and the Iberian Peninsula. In East Asia, they are notably found in China, Korea, and Japan. This range provides varied climates and landscapes for the species.
Another distinct population exists in Spain and Portugal, isolated from their Asian relatives. The presence in these regions showcases their remarkable adaptability to different geographic conditions.
Their distribution in Europe and Asia underscores a significant gap, highlighting fascinating questions about their migratory and evolutionary history. Adaptation to diverse climates and terrains is a key feature of their wide distribution.
Physical Characteristics
The azure-winged magpie is a medium-sized bird that stands out due to its slim profile and eye-catching color palette. It combines sleek black, bright blue, and soft gray tones to create a striking appearance.
Distinctive Features
Azure-winged magpies measure approximately 31-35 centimeters in length, making them comparable in size to the Eurasian magpie, albeit more slender. They have proportionately smaller legs and bills, which contribute to their elegant and streamlined look.
These birds belong to the genus Cyanopica and exhibit a long, graceful tail which often makes up a significant portion of their body length. Their agile frame helps them maneuver through dense vegetation and perform impressive aerial displays.
Coloration and Size
The plumage of the azure-winged magpie is notable for its deep blue wings and tail, which contrast sharply with its jet-black head and neck. This black cap extends to the eyes and is complemented by a white throat, adding to its striking appearance.
Their back is typically a pale brown, while the underparts are a light gray. This combination of colors not only makes them easily identifiable but also assists in blending with their natural habitat, providing some degree of camouflage from predators.
Weighing between 70-110 grams, azure-winged magpies possess a lightweight build that aids in their frequent, swift flights. This balance of vivid color and agile form underscores their unique and captivating presence in the avian world.

Reproduction and Lifespan
Azure-winged magpies exhibit unique breeding patterns and nesting habits that are essential to their lifecycle and survival. Their reproductive strategies and life expectancy are shaped by their social behaviors and environmental factors.
Breeding Patterns
Azure-winged magpies generally begin their breeding season in late spring. Pairs form monogamous bonds and often stay together for multiple seasons. Courtship involves intricate displays, including mutual preening.
Females typically lay 5-8 eggs per clutch, with incubation lasting around 15-17 days. Both parents share responsibilities in feeding and protecting their young. Juveniles leave the nest approximately 3 weeks after hatching and remain with their parents for an extended period, providing support and learning essential survival skills.
Nesting Habits
These birds prefer building their nests in dense shrubs or trees, choosing locations that offer ample cover and protection from predators. The nest is constructed with twigs, grass, and roots, and is typically lined with softer materials like feathers.
Social birds, azure-winged magpies often breed in small colonies. They sometimes build multiple nests close together, encouraging cooperative breeding. Non-breeding individuals may assist in raising the young, enhancing the survival rate of the offspring.
Nesting sites are usually reused or refurbished in subsequent years, reducing the need to find new territories annually. This consistent nesting behavior helps maintain their population stability and fosters a strong community structure.
